Реактивный ИИ

В начале развития искусственного интеллекта одной из первых и самых простых концепций была реактивная ИИ. Как можно догадаться из названия, реактивный ИИ просто реагирует на определённые команды заранее запрограммированными действиями. В отличие от более продвинутых систем, реактивный ИИ не имеет памяти и не может учиться. Он работает только с текущими данными и выполняет ограниченные, но точно заданные задачи. Эта глава раскрывает ключевые черты реактивного ИИ, его плюсы и минусы, а также его значимость в мире искусственного интеллекта. На сегодняшний день реактивный ИИ остаётся основой многих приложений ИИ.

Основные характеристики реактивного ИИ

Реактивный ИИ строится на простых правилах, не имея памяти или возможности анализировать прошлый опыт. Это означает, что он реагирует исключительно на текущие сигналы. Его действия базируются на заранее определённых правилах, что делает такие системы надёжными в простых и предсказуемых условиях, но неэффективными в более сложных и изменчивых средах.

  • Отсутствие памяти и обучения: реактивный ИИ работает только с текущими сигналами, не запоминая и не анализируя прошлые данные, что делает его простым и быстрым.

  • Ориентация на конкретные задачи: он разработан для выполнения одних и тех же задач, не адаптируясь к новым условиям.

  • Надёжность и предсказуемость: реактивный ИИ выдаёт одинаковые результаты, что особенно ценно в автоматизации.

  • Отсутствие сложного анализа: в основе реактивного ИИ — простые “если-то” правила, поэтому он не способен планировать или анализировать.

Примеры применения реактивного ИИ

Несмотря на свою простоту, реактивный ИИ востребован благодаря скорости и надёжности, особенно для повторяющихся задач.

  • Игры: один из известных примеров — компьютер Deep Blue от IBM, который в 1997 году победил чемпиона мира по шахматам Гарри Каспарова. Deep Blue рассчитывал лучший ход, исходя из текущего состояния партии, не запоминая предыдущие игры.

  • Спам-фильтры: простые спам-фильтры работают по правилам — сообщения со «спамными» ключевыми словами или ссылками отправляются в папку «спам». Ранние версии таких фильтров были чисто реактивными, без анализа поведения пользователей.

  • Роботы для уборки: автономные пылесосы типа первых моделей Roomba работают как реактивный ИИ, реагируя на препятствия и изменяя направление движения, но не запоминая местоположение объектов.

  • Рекомендательные системы: ранние рекомендации на платформах, таких как стриминговые сервисы, также использовали реактивные алгоритмы, предлагая контент по простым критериям, например, популярности или жанру.

Преимущества и ограничения реактивного ИИ

Преимущества:

  • Скорость и эффективность: реагирует моментально, что полезно для задач, где важна мгновенная реакция.

  • Надёжность: простота и предсказуемость обеспечивают надёжную работу в рутинных процессах.

  • Простота поддержки: нет необходимости в обучении и обновлении данных.

Ограничения:

  • Отсутствие адаптации: реактивные ИИ не обучаются, поэтому их сложно применять в меняющихся условиях.

  • Не подходит для сложных задач: не способен к стратегическому планированию или анализу.

  • Ограничен конкретной задачей: нельзя перенастроить для выполнения других функций.

Роль реактивного ИИ в мире искусственного интеллекта

Хотя современные разработки ИИ направлены на более продвинутые системы, реактивный ИИ по-прежнему остаётся основой множества приложений. Например, в автономных транспортных средствах принципы реактивного ИИ помогают в избегании препятствий, пока более сложные системы отвечают за такие задачи, как планирование маршрута. Также он важен в производственных процессах, где ценится стабильность и предсказуемость.

Реактивный ИИ позволяет гарантировать безопасность, ведь его поведение предсказуемо и легко тестируется, что особенно важно в таких областях, как медицина и авиация.

Заключение

Реактивный ИИ, несмотря на отсутствие памяти и способности к обучению, остаётся значимой частью ИИ. Он эффективен в простых задачах, где нужна надёжность и предсказуемость. Как самый простой вид ИИ, он помогает автоматизировать процессы и обеспечивает стабильность в самых разных приложениях. С развитием ИИ реактивные системы, вероятно, останутся важной базой для базовой автоматизации и поддержки более сложных систем там, где требуется быстрая реакция.

Last updated